We love our four-legged friends here at the Hole in the Wall. So much so, that we are delighted to announce that we are dedicating one day a week to man’s best friend! Introducing Dog De Déardaoin, the Hole in the Wall pub is now a dog-friendly environment every Thursday! So, bring your pooch and shelter from the Irish weather.

We do kindly ask you to adhere to the following when visiting the Hole in the Wall with your furry friend:
1. Keep your pooch on a lead at all times.
2. If you encounter someone with a guide dog or assistance dog, shorten the lead so that your dog can not reach over to sniff and greet the guide dog or assistance dog, essentially distracting them from their work of keeping their owner safe.
3. Encourage your dog to sit alongside your feet or under the dining table. It is important your pet does not block the way.
4. It may be beneficial for you to carry some of your dog’s food, alternatively ask if we have some dog treat samples to reward them for being a good doggy.
5. If you have a small dog you may consider picking him/her up and carrying them in your arms when passing by someone with a guide dog or assistance dog.
6. It is important to still respect others and we encourage good doggy-etiquette
7. We will gladly welcome well-behaved dogs back every Thursday!

EVERYONES WORST FEAR
Hi, I for one cannot sleep most nights from seeing all the photos on all the lost and stolen dog pages of beloved and treasured pets being ripped from their Families by thieves.

Dog theft is at it's highest because these horrid people have been out of work through Covid-19.

So here are some simple but vital tips I hope you find helpful:

Please make sure your dogs microchip details are properly REGISTERED and are up to date. If you have changed phone number, home address or ownership of the pet please update it online.
* I ask my vet to scan everytime I go in for a visit (which might be twice a year), at first just in case I hadn't done it properly and ever since just in case there is ever a computer glitch on the other side.

It is also a legal requirement to have an ID tag on your dog and where possible I would suggest you have 2 contact numbers in case one person cannot answer the phone when needed.

A vital piece of information for your dog tag is to state "I AM NEUTERED". This has resulted in many dogs stolen being left far closer to home than without it.

Photos: My dog has some very unusual markings under his coat so I have taken photos of these when he has been groomed so I have extra proof of ownership.

If you have to leave your dog home alone ask a a trusted neighbour or neighbours who you know will be home for that duration to keep an extra eye on your house.

Please familiarise yourself with all the current lost and found dog pages on social media.
* As I come across a new page I write it down.

If your dog is lost or you feel stolen ALWAYS ring you local Garda Stations immediately. They are very invested in this problem and I have seen from various pages that a lot of stolen dogs have been returned due to the Guards efforts.

If you are engaging with and or paying professional dog walkers to walk your dog for the first time please ensure you research them in GREAT detail or better still invest in Daycare such as us or those anywhere in your home/work vacinity. Again, please research these well. The Daycare industry in Ireland are very respectful of each other and we all help one another in any way we can.

Please be vigilant at all times of who is watching or interacting with you while you are walking your dog, they may be following you home.
